    Trying to switch my authority category from HOUSEHOLD GOODS to common freight. Already switched it on mcs 150. But safer snapshot still says authorized for HHG. FMCSA has told me 3 different answers including “I’m to go”. Another agent said “Can’t be done” another said “fill out OP-1 to switch.” Another said “fill out OP-1 and add another authority to existing number”

    Spend $35 and become a member of OOIDA.

    Then you can call them and they either will do it for you for a small fee, or they'll explain to you how to do it.

    They will also answer any questions that you have about compliance, or your authority, or anything regarding FMCSA or regulations or anything else regarding trucking.

    And if you know how to navigate it, they have pretty good tire discounts and other things too.

    As far as I'm concerned, it's the best $35 you're ever going to spend in this business.
